titleOfInvention Grout, use of grout and method of grouting
abstract The invention relates to a grout, especially for joints to be filled in-situ for interior design, drywall, window construction and the like, wherein the grout is a grout based on an acrylate or a mixture of at least two acrylates and - that the grout is light-curing or - That the grout is curable in a dual-cure process, wherein the grout is light and moisture curing, wherein the grout has at least one, upon exposure to light having a wavelength or wavelength range greater than or equal to 280nm to 600nm a polymerization process starting photoinitiator , The invention also relates to the use of grout and a method for grouting.
